Overview

Located in Kensington with stately Victorian buildings and embassies, the 4-star Mercure London Kensington Hotel is approximately a 25-minute walk from such culture-oriented attractions as Saatchi Gallery. Guests are offered with private car parking at extra cost on site.

Location

This London hotel is situated merely 1.4 km from Leighton House Museum and in close proximity to Earl's Court underground station. The hotel provides history lovers with proximity to Kensington Palace (2 km) and Buckingham Palace (3.5 km). Families travelling to London will enjoy being within a 6-km distance of Coca-Cola London Eye.

Mercure London Kensington Hotel is also approximately a 10-minute walk from London West Brompton train station and not very far from Natural History Museum.

Rooms

Facing the inner courtyard, some of the 82 rooms come with a flat-screen TV with satellite channels and wireless internet, and such essentials as an iron with ironing board and central heating. Nice touches include a separate toilet and a shower, along with a hairdryer and towels.

Eat & Drink

The Mercure London Kensington offers breakfast in the restaurant. This London property is within short walking distance of The Bottlery serving British dishes.

Leisure & Business

Corporate travellers will benefit from a business centre available on site.
